The Zilla Parishad Nashik recently concluded its District-level Computer Science Hackathon, held at Horizon Academy, Gangapur Road, on April 28, 2025. The hackathon was an inspiring initiative aimed at promoting coding, computational thinking, and 21st-century skills among students from rural areas.

The event saw enthusiastic participation from 30 teams, each representing the winners of the block-level hackathons. These teams presented innovative technological solutions focused on critical social issues like Swachh Bharat, water scarcity, school management, and superstition awareness. The creativity and problem-solving abilities showcased by the students were truly impressive.
As the Chief Guest, Shreekant Patil, Chairman of the NIMA Startup Committee, was honored to be a part of this important event. He was felicitated by Deputy Education Officer Dhananjay Koli, and presented awards to the winning students for their exceptional projects. Mr. Patil, who is a strong advocate for entrepreneurship and innovation, also guided students and teachers on the Startup India initiative, sharing insights on how they can create and scale businesses in rural India.
In addition, Mr. Shreekant Patil committed to conducting a capacity-building program for Zilla Parishad teachers on the Startup India ecosystem and entrepreneurship. The goal of this program is to equip teachers from across Nashik’s talukas with the knowledge and tools they need to guide their students toward entrepreneurial success.
